FormerCIADi- rector David Petraeus, whose career was destroyed by an extramarital af- fair with his biographer, was sen- tenced Thursday to two years' pro- bation and fined $100,000 for giving her classified material while she was working on the book. The sentencing came two months after he agreed to plead guilty to a fed- eral misdemeanor count of unauthor- ized removal and retention of classi- fied material. The plea agreement car- ried a possible sentence of up to a year in prison. In court papers, prosecutors recommended two years of probation and a $40,000 fine. In a stunning development, Saudi Arabia had declared on Tuesday that it was halting coalition air- strikes targeting Yemen's Shiite reb- els known as Houthis — a four-week air campaign meant to halt the rebel power grab. A new Pentagon cybersecurity strategy lays out for the first time publicly that the U.S. military plans to use cyberwarfare as an option in conflicts with ene- mies. The 33-page strategy says the De- fense Department "should be able to use cyber operations to disrupt an adversary's command and con- trol networks, military-related crit- ical infrastructure and weapons ca- pabilities." Germany and France pledged two ships while Britain committed three to move into the Mediterra- nean, and other member states also lined up more vessels and helicop- ters. Rep. Trey Gowdy, R-S.C., said he wants Clinton to testify the week of May 18 and again before June 18. Michael Brown's par- ents filed a wrongful-death law- suit against the city of Ferguson on Thursday, opening a new chapter in the legal battle over the shooting that killed their son and sparked a national protest movement about the way police treat blacks. Attorneys for Brown's parents promised the case would bring to light new forensic evidence and raise doubts about the police version of events. Some of that evidence, they said, had been overlooked.
